In "Etiquette in Society, in Business, in Politics, and at Home," Emily Post explores the importance of proper behavior and decorum in all aspects of life. Drawing on her own experiences and extensive research, Post offers practical advice and guidance on navigating social situations with grace and ease. Whether you're attending a formal dinner party, conducting business negotiations, or running for political office, Post's timeless wisdom will help you make a good impression and build lasting relationships. From the proper way to introduce yourself to others, to the etiquette of gift-giving and thank-you notes, to the nuances of international protocol, Post covers it all with warmth, wit, and a deep understanding of human nature. This classic guide to etiquette was first published in 1922, yet its core principles remain as relevant as ever in today's modern times. About the Author: Emily Post (1872-1960) was an American author and etiquette expert. Born in Baltimore, Maryland, Post grew up in a wealthy family and was educated at home by private tutors. In 1892, she married Edwin Main Post, a banker and real estate developer. After her husband's death in 1905, Post began writing to support herself and her two sons. In 1922, she published her first book on etiquette, "Etiquette in Society, in Business, in Politics, and at Home," which became a bestseller and established her as an authority on the subject. Post went on to write several more books on etiquette, as well as novels, short stories, and newspaper columns. She also lectured extensively on the topic and hosted a radio program, "Emily Post's Etiquette," in the 1930s. Throughout her career, Post emphasized the importance of treating others with kindness and respect, regardless of their social status or background. Her practical advice and common-sense approach to etiquette made her a beloved figure in American culture, and her legacy continues to influence manners and social norms today.
